Convert 30 109/25 as an improper fraction

To turn the mixed number 30 109/25 into an improper fraction, use these simple steps:

First, multiply the whole number by the denominator of the fractional part: 30 × 25 = 750.

After that, add the result to the numerator of the fractional part: 750 + 109 = 859.

Next, Write the sum of the previous step on the original denominator: 859/25.

This means that 30 109/25, as an improper fraction, equals 859/25.
